### Alert: WavePeek Preview Render Failures

Fires when the WavePeek service fails to generate audio waveform previews for more than 5% of uploads over ten minutes. Common causes: corrupt source files, decoder pool exhaustion, or stale codec images. Check the decoder logs first, then the upload validator. If failures persist after a pool restart, escalate to the media pipeline team at the address below.

escalation mailbox, hadug-bajog: sormir@norvalabs.internal

// SEAT_MAP_GRID_SCALE — Marbury Theatre renderer
//
// Controls pixel density of the seat-map grid. Changing this
// invalidates cached layouts for all Marbury venues; a full
// re-render is forced on next deploy. Do not bump mid-season
// without sign-off. Release manager: verify the shipped value
// matches the build token recorded below.

pipeline stamp: htk6_7941f2

## v3.8.2 — Fixed: intermittent DNS resolution failures

Plugin authors reported sporadic resolver timeouts when Hookfern dispatched outbound callbacks under load. The cause was a cached negative DNS response held past its TTL in our connection pool. We now honor TTLs strictly and retry once with a fresh lookup before surfacing an error. No plugin-side changes are required. If you still observe failures after upgrading, contact the maintainer responsible for this fix, named below.

account owner for fajep-yagef: Kasix Eliiel